China has been producing new billionaires — especially female billionaires — much faster than any other country in the world.
Yes, but: The U.S., second by a large margin, produces billionaires and companies with much bigger global influence.
By the numbers: China and the U.S. together have produced 55% of the world’s “known” billionaires, according to Hurun’s 2022 Global Rich List.
China has more total billionaires: 1,133 to the U.S.’ 716. And its billionaire population is growing about three times faster than America’s, according to Hurun.
The three cities with the biggest billionaire populations are now all in China: Shenzhen just overtook New York City for third place.
But America’s billionaires are still wealthier than China’s. They control about 32% of the combined wealth of all the “known billionaires” in the world, while China’s billionaires account for about 27% of that wealth.
